So, 'Full Moon Glory Hole' is this wild little horror flick that dives deep into the underbelly of human desire and fear. The whole vibe is super grimy, like you can almost smell the mildew from the gas station bathroom. It's all about atmosphere, really – that tension builds up as Francis ventures into the unknown, and then boom, it hits you with some gnarly practical effects that feel raw and grimy. The pacing is kind of relentless, which adds to the mounting dread. Performances are surprisingly engaging; they tap into that awkwardness of the situation and the horror of the unknown. It's not your everyday horror narrative – it’s distinct, and yeah, it’s definitely gonna stick in your mind for a bit. Just a unique take on some familiar themes of temptation and consequence, all under a full moon's eerie glow.
